Subject: Sweeper duty

Welcome aboard. You now co-own the Marrowfield orphaned-resource sweeper. It runs hourly, deletes untagged volumes and stale snapshots older than seven days. If it pages, check the dry-run log before anything else — false positives happen. Never disable it outright; pause the delete stage instead. Full procedures are documented at the page below.

runbook for badug-kadup: https://confluence.zemvarlabs.internal/projects/browse/display/projects/bd1b

Ticket: Config drift in snapshot test runner

Support has seen inconsistent snapshot failures on Glintframe UI builds. Root cause is configuration drift: two runner pools were updated with different viewport and threshold settings, so identical components produce mismatched baselines. Until the pools are realigned, advise customers to rerun on the primary pool. The intended canonical runner configuration is listed below.

settings of fajog-kajof:
julwyn:
  pin: 0480
  tenant: rusok
  seal: seal_456f5567
  metrics_host: metrics.julwyn.qirvangrid.local
  standby_team: rusath
  escalation: eliael-jorax
  nonce: ca9746

During scheduled load testing of the Pennywhistle checkout flow, synthetic traffic from the Draughtline harness exceeded its approved envelope and triggered rate-limit exhaustion on the payment gateway shim. While this traffic is internally generated, reviewers should verify that no production credentials were exercised and that test card tokens remained confined to the sandbox tier. Full request captures are retained for fourteen days in the audit vault. To request captures or dispute scope, write to the address below.

billing contact of yawip-yadup = druath.casdor@nelvrolabs.internal

Nobody noticed because the fallback path quietly shipped uncompressed batches, which blew past our bandwidth budget. We've shortened the rotation window and added an expiry alarm. Root cause writeup is attached to the parent epic; this ticket just tracks the credential swap itself. The freshly issued key for the compressor service follows immediately below.

API key for yahig-tadup: kto7_ubizbYm